Title :
Conductive polymer/insulating polymer composite films using molecular self-assembly

Abstract :
By exposing low-density polyethylene to an atmosphere of fluming sulfuric acid, sulfonated low-density polyethylenes (SPE) were prepared. The degree of surface sulfonation of the treated film was determined from the weight increase per unit area. Polypyrrole (PPy) films on the surface of SPE were grown by a molecular self-assembly process and the properties of PPy/SPE composite films have been investigated. Functional applications of PPy/SPE composite films have also been proposed
